Beijing (Gasgoo)- On September 20, 2024, Zhuoyu (formerly DJI Automotive) and NVIDIA held a partnership ceremony to announce their collaboration on developing flagship intelligent driving solutions, leveraging NVIDIA's next-generation centralized vehicle computing platform, NVIDIA DRIVE Thor.

Zhuoyu will develop its next-generation flagship adv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S) on the NVIDIA DRIVE Thor platform, which is powered by NVIDIA DriveOS. This collaboration aims to provide Chinese automakers with innovative, high-performance intelligent transportation solutions, particularly in the premium vehicle segment.

The DRIVE Thor platform is designed for automotive applications involving generative AI, offering a safer, more reliable, and enjoyable driving experience. It integrates NVIDIA's latest CPU and GPU technologies, including the Blackwell GPU architecture for Transformer and generative AI functionalities. The platform enables high-level autonomous driving and unmanned driving capabilities, consolidating all functions onto a single centralized platform, improving efficiency, reliability, and reducing overall system costs.

Zhuoyu has been working with NVIDIA since 2021, with its advanced smart driving system already running on the NVIDIA DRIVE Orin platform, integrated into mass-production vehicles. Zhuoyu’s “Chengxing Platform” is compatible with multiple chip platforms, maximizing computing power while lowering the barrier for automakers to deploy smart driving solutions.

By 2025, Zhuoyu will harness DRIVE Thor’s 1,000 TOPS of computing power to advance large model deveployment in intelligent driving and deliver enhanced driving experiences, making cutting-edge technology accessible across mainstream vehicles.

[SMM Daily Review: Spot Lithium Carbonate Prices Fluctuated Upward on March 13] SMM's battery-grade lithium carbonate index price fluctuated upward from the previous working day. Futures trend, the most-traded contract fluctuated higher after opening and once climbed to around 163,000 yuan/mt; after the midday session, the price reversed downward and once fell to 150,000 yuan/mt near the close, then fluctuated rangebound at low levels until the close. As of the close, open interest for the day decreased by about 8,500 lots from the previous trading day. Actual transactions, upstream lithium chemical plants showed a clear reluctance to sell and held prices firm, while willingness to sell spot orders remained weak; downstream material plants still mainly stayed cautious and on the sidelines, maintaining only just-in-time procurement. Overall, both market inquiries and actual transactions were sluggish. As for subsequent price movements, given that downstream procurement sentiment remained cautious and the market lacked sustained momentum to chase higher prices, lithium carbonate prices were expected to continue a fluctuating trend in the short term.

On March 13, the China Automobile Dealers Association released the results of its February 2026 "Automobile Dealer Inventory" survey: the comprehensive inventory coefficient of automobile dealers was 1.95 in February, up 31.8% MoM and up 21.1% YoY. According to data from the CPCA under the China Automobile Dealers Association, passenger vehicle retail sales totaled 1.043 million units in February. Based on this, total dealer inventory at month-end February was estimated at about 2 million units.

[Aptiv’s 2025 Results Hit a Record High, with Full-Year Revenue of $20.4 Billion] Recently, Aptiv released its 2025 financial results, with full-year revenue, adjusted operating income, and adjusted earnings per share all reaching record highs. Revenue reached $20.4 billion, up 3% YoY; adjusted operating income was $2.461 billion, adjusted EBITDA was $3.228 billion, and diluted earnings per share excluding special items reached $7.82.
